** The Audi repair market for Wishek, ND, is almost entirely external. There are no dedicated Audi specialists within the city limits. Residents must travel to Bismarck (~100 miles) or Fargo (~150 miles) for specialized care. The market in these regional hubs is moderately competitive, with a clear distinction between the official dealership (Audi Fargo) and high-quality independent specialists (Euro Service, Ternes Auto Body). **Average Quality:** The quality of service available is high, with several shops boasting ASE and manufacturer-specific certified technicians. The independents compete effectively with the dealership on expertise for older models, often at a lower cost. **Competition Level:** Moderate in Bismarck and Fargo. The presence of a dedicated European specialist and a reputable dealership creates a healthy competitive environment that benefits the consumer.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are consistent with specialized automotive repair. Dealership rates are typically the highest ($150-$180/hr), while top-tier independents are slightly more affordable ($120-$150/hr). The cost of parts, especially for performance and turbo systems, remains significant regardless of the provider. For Wishek residents, travel time and potential for vehicle towing must be factored into the overall service cost.
